With summer coming soon I think this is the year to buy a true pocket gun in 9MM unless I can find a .380 with a muzzle velocity that's acceptable. I know that the proper ammo is needed also so if anybody is aware of a good combo please let me know. I already own a Walther PPK/S in .380 but believe me, it's not even close to being a pocket gun.
So far I've been investigating the following: Kahr PM9 Kahr CM9 Ruger LC9 Sig P290 Ruger SR9 The overall length of these is close to 5" max. and mags are either 6 or 7 rounds. I've seen many more but when I see a gun selling for $150 I just have to close my eyes and keep going. Are there any more candidates I should consider before I try to make a decision? the parameters I have are: 1. 9mm 2. Close to 5" overall length 3. 6-7 round mags with pinky extensions as an option. 4. Plastic frame and steel slide 5. No Glocks--they all look the same to me. 6. I'd like to keep the price below $650 Any suggestions? ![]()
